Photographs of Famous Trainers, Owners, and Others Associated with the Sport of Kings (67+)

The lot offers the opportunity to own original photos of once important individuals involved in the sport, several taken by noted photographers, and difficult to obtain. (Trainers - 23) Ben Jones & son Jimmy (12), Sunny Jim Fitzsimmons (5) - one by C.C. Cook, Maz Hirsch (2), Louis Feustel (Man O' War’s trainer) by C.C. Cook, Woody Stephens, Reggie Cornell, and Iloratio Luro (the latter’s photo was used for the Turf & Sport magazine) (Owners — 17) James Keene, A.G. Vanderbilt, Pete Bostwiek, August Belmont by Barn News, and the Phipps family (13). (Others — 27+) Chief Long — longtime GM of Pimlico & Laurel racecourse (14), Edgar Horn — editor of the Turf & Sport Digest (5) with Turf & Sport file folder, W. Montague — founder of the Turf & Sport Digest (2), a blocker, strike at Santa Anita, a bugler, Santa Anita press box, horse observers at Hollywood Park - an innovation whereby each was assigned a specific horse in a race, and getting ready for opening day at Jamaica racetrack plus a few others.
